BV fleet tops 80 million gt

The growth has been led by the delivery of 320 new vessels

and

the transfer in of 198 vessels in service since the beginning of the year. The fleet is well balanced in tonnage, with 37% bulk carriers, 20% tankers, 8% gas carriers, 5% passenger vessels, 14% containerships

and

16% specialised

and

offshore vessels.

Significant new additions to the BV class fleet in the last month include two Capesize bulk carriers built in China for Greek shipowner Centrofin Management Inc

and

for American shipowner Foremost Group,

and

the two 75,200 dwt bulk carriers

Good Luck

and

Good Wish

built in China for Chinese shipowner Pacific Wealth Shipping. These vessels joined the BV class fleet on the day it passed the 80 million gt mark. On the same day, Greek shipmanager Quintana Ship Management transferred the 82,200 dwt bulk carrier

Q Jake

, delivered in March 2011, to BV class.
